The 40' × 80' barn/shop anchors a genuine equestrian facility: three interior 12' × 12' stalls (one thoughtfully converted to a bunk room with kitchenette), an indoor wash rack, and a dedicated tack room. Outside, five generous 35' × 35' covered stalls -- one fully enclosed -- plus a 15' × 15' enclosed hay barn, a separate enclosed tractor barn, a 30' round pen, and a 120' × 120' arena. Ten acres of grazing pasture complete the picture, with a custom tree fort tucked in for good measure. All of this just minutes from Flagstaff and equal distance to Williams, in the pines of Parks -- where the pace is slower, the land is bigger, and the horses are always in view.
